A plucky chihuahua went toe-to-toe with a pair of shotgun-wielding robbers trying to rob a California smoke shop -- yipping furiously and chasing them out of the store.  

Wearing black hooded jackets and armed with a rifle, the two thieves burst into a tobacco store in Altadena near Los Angeles demanding money, according to USA Today.  

However, when the owner began handing over cash from the till, his tiny pet started barking frenetically.  

The diminutive dog named Paco refused to be intimidated, even when one of the robbers pointed the barrel of his weapon at him, eventually chasing the men out of the shop and down the street, USA Today reported.
